Know Your Size & Boot Fit

It’s easy to assume your shoe size will stay the same for years, but even tiny changes can make a big difference in comfort and performance. That old-school metal Brannock device at sporting goods stores is still reliable when it comes to getting accurate measurements — so don’t be afraid of trying something outside that range if necessary.

 And smart shoppers know never to try on new footwear first thing in the morning; feet swell as you go about daily activities, making them bigger by day’s end –so always aim for an afternoon or evening fitting session whenever possible. Finally, if there’s any tightness around those toes right away, get yourself up half a size. Your future self with thank you later…

Avoid Hot Spots & Get Your System Down Early

When shopping for new boots, try them on with the socks you plan to wear while hunting. If it’s cold and wet outside, hunt down a pair that will keep your feet warm and dry – don’t forget extra insulation. But if you’re aiming for an early-season excursion in warmer temperatures, check breathability too.

 Look out for blister hotspots before heading into the wilds; better safe than sorry. And finally, find insoles and lacing systems suited just right to get everything fitting perfectly snugly (try Superfeet.).

Tall, Medium, or Low Shaft

Many hikers prefer the mid-height boot, which comes up to ankle height, as it offers a great balance between protection and lightweight comfort.

But for those in need of extra support when tromping over rugged terrain – or simply who don’t want snow seeping into their boots during cold winter hikes – taller shafted hiking boots are an ideal option that provides both stability and weatherproofing against all kinds of conditions.

A low-top shoe is ideal for lightweight hiking with maximum comfort. However, these shoes don’t provide as much protection from dust and snow. To combat this problem while avoiding excessive weight, pair the boots with some gaiters; you’ll have confidence knowing your feet will remain dry no matter how deep the powdery white stuff gets.

Insulated vs. non-insulated boots

Insulated boots are a staple of late-season hunts – but they’re often overvalued and misunderstood in western backcountry hunting. Instead of presuming an insulated boot will be the only way you’ll stay warm during long treks through mountainous terrain, consider how much walking versus sitting you plan on doing; with enough circulation, your feet can become quite cozy without added insulation. 

Everyone is different, so trial-and-error may help determine what’s best for keeping those toes comfortable (while avoiding dreaded sweat.).
